Prosser, Washington Jail and Mugshot Information
Prosser is a city in Benton County, Washington. According to the United States Census Bureau, the city has a total area of 4.77 square miles (12.35 sq. km). The City of Prosser had a population of approximately 5,714 in the year 2010.

Violent crime rate in 2017 in Prosser: 172.4; U.S. Average: 214.8
Violent crime rate in 2016 in Prosser: 135.7; U.S. Average: 216.3
Facts about crime in Prosser, Washington:
The overall crime rate in Prosser is equal to the national average.
For every 100,000 people, there are 7.56 daily crimes that occur in Prosser.
Prosser is safer than 34% of the cities in the United States.
In Prosser you have a 1 in 37 chance of becoming a victim of any crime.
The number of total year over year crimes in Prosser has increased by 42%.
